Transaction 23d2892d58e721ab49dd7123cfd8de0a529bc6175584f467da80ed2921c37f18
1 Input
1 Output
-
23d2892d58e721ab49dd7123cfd8de0a529bc6175584f467da80ed2921c37f18:0
- value
- 1251490
- script pubkey
- OP_0 OP_PUSHBYTES_20 fba1bbf2dcfadf3e8a3a01137f6a94a76105aa98
- address
- bc1qlwsmhukult0naz36qyfh76555asst25ckqz95v